2. Find your next job

LinkedIn has become a powerful tool for professionals looking to grow in their careers. The platform offers several features that can help job seekers find their next opportunity, including Career Explorer and the Open to Work feature.

To start, head to the Career Explorer tool and select your job role and desired location. This will give you an idea of the job opportunities available in your field and area. To get more specific results, use keywords relevant to your skills and interests.

Next, make sure to activate the Open to Work feature. This feature lets recruiters know that you are actively looking for job opportunities. You can also set your preferences for the type of job you are looking for and your desired salary range.

To stay on top of new job matches, set up alerts for job openings that match your criteria. This will ensure that you don’t miss out on any potential opportunities.

In addition to using these features, it’s important to leverage your network on LinkedIn. Reach out to connections and ask for referrals or job opportunities. You never know who might have the perfect job opening for you.

LinkedIn’s job search app is another valuable tool for finding job opportunities. With the app, you can apply for jobs with just one tap and even see who you are connected with at the company.

LinkedIn offers several features that can help you find your next job and advance in your career. Make sure to use Career Explorer, activate the Open to Work feature, set up job alerts, and leverage your network to increase your chances of landing your dream job.

4. Use Social Proof To Demonstrate Your Influence

Social proof is a powerful tool to help establish your influence on LinkedIn. Social proof refers to the concept that people are influenced by the actions and opinions of others. In the context of LinkedIn, this means demonstrating that you have a following and that others respect your opinions and expertise.

One way to demonstrate social proof on LinkedIn is through endorsements and recommendations. Endorsements are quick and easy to give, and they can help to showcase specific skills and abilities that you want to highlight. Recommendations are more detailed and require more effort, but they can be more impactful because they offer a more personalized perspective on your work.

Another way to establish social proof on LinkedIn is through the use of statistics and metrics. For example, if you have a large number of followers or connections, this can demonstrate that your content is valued and respected by others in your field. Similarly, if you have high engagement rates on your posts, this can show that your content is relevant and interesting to your audience.

You can also use social proof to your advantage by highlighting any awards, certifications, or other accolades you have received. These can serve as a tangible symbol of your expertise and authority in your field.

Finally, you can establish social proof by engaging with other influencers and thought leaders in your industry. This can help to connect you with new audiences and demonstrate that you are plugged in to the latest trends and developments in your field.
